QUOTE(stormer @ Sep 20 2008, 10:34 PM)
Hello guys/girls,

I'm just curious what are the best view (screen resolution) for LCD 19" widescreen. Currently mine are set to 1024 x 768 but recommendate are 1440 x 900.

I once setted to 1440 x 900 but everything looks small to me (fonts...etc..etc)  biggrin.gif

I would like to hear from the other forumer, what are the screen resolution currently they set to their LCD 19 " widescreen...?

TIA
*
Normally the best setting is the native resolution, for 19' widescreen is 1440x900. Because if you set to a lower resolution, the image is not sharp anymore as the LCD has to scale down to the lower resolution.

I think most of us will stick to the native resolution as it gives the best image quality.

The font is slightly smaller, but you will get use to it.
